Burning Problem

I have an intermittent problem with burning DVDs - actually it's more a regular problem that intermittently doesn't occur.

I'm using DVD Fab Platinum with which I back up the DVD to my hard drive without a problem.

Then when I try to burn (via DVDFab Patinum) the movie to disc I get the problem. It just stops at a certain point - there's no error message, the program keeps running, but the percentage completed stays at at 4.9% or 60.37% or whatever it is and doesn't change. It would go on all night without changing if I left it.

I'm using Windows XP Home
The DVD player is a HL-DT-ST DVD-RW GCA-4080N
I'm not sure what the burner is - it just happens under the DVDFab page, but I have a Nero Express 6.3.1.6 on my computer. I also have listed under Device Managers: "VSO Devices" and "pccoufin device", if that means anything.

Any help would be appreciated. I'm going through a mountain of discs with a very small success rate at the moment.
